Mastering the Planer Machine Application: A Complete Guide to Flattening and Smoothing Wood

In modern manufacturing and woodworking, the planer machine application stands as a cornerstone for achieving precision and surface perfection. This specialized equipment is engineered to shave off microscopic layers of material, creating surfaces that are impeccably flat and smooth. Whether working with hardwoods, plastics, or composites, the machine ensures dimensional stability and consistency that manual processes cannot match. Understanding its capabilities is essential for any operation demanding high-volume quality output.

The primary planer machine application revolves around the systematic removal of material to correct thickness and improve surface integrity. Unlike simple sanding, this process utilizes a powered cutting tool—typically a helical head with multiple carbide inserts—to cleanly shear away chips from the workpiece. This action not only flattens the surface but also refines the internal fiber structure, reducing tear-out and creating a more uniform material density. The adjustment of the cutter head allows for fine-tuning the depth of cut, accommodating rough passes or delicate finishing touches.

When dimensional accuracy is non-negotiable, the planer machine application excels. Industries requiring tight tolerances, such as cabinetry and aerospace component fabrication, rely on this machinery to ensure every board meets exact specifications. By feeding material through a consistent gap, the machine guarantees uniform thickness across entire sheets or lengths. This capability is critical for projects where components must interlock perfectly, eliminating gaps or misalignment in the final assembly. The result is a product that fits seamlessly without the need for excessive sanding or trimming.

While often associated with woodworking shops, the planer machine application extends far beyond traditional carpentry. In metalworking, variants known as metal planers or milling machines handle hardened steels and alloys, preparing surfaces for welding or plating. The adaptability of these machines allows them to process a wide array of materials, including reclaimed wood, MDF, and composites. This versatility makes them indispensable in manufacturing plants, custom furniture studios, and repair facilities where material diversity is constant.

  • Woodworking: Creating cabinet doors, table tops, and furniture components with flawless grain alignment.
  • Automotive: Refinishing engine blocks and chassis parts to restore dimensional specifications.
  • Construction: Preparing laminated timber beams for structural integrity.
  • Art Restoration: Cleaning and flattening antique wood panels without damaging historical integrity.

A crucial planer machine application is the preparation of surfaces for final finishing processes. A perfectly planar surface accepts paint, stain, or varnish more evenly, resulting in a professional-grade appearance. Rough or uneven substrates often lead to pooling and blemishes in finishes; however, the smooth output from a planer provides an ideal canvas. This pre-processing step significantly reduces the need for extensive hand-sanding, saving time and labor costs while elevating the overall aesthetic quality.

Operational Efficiency and Workflow Integration

Integrating a planer machine application into a workflow dramatically boosts productivity and consistency. Automated feed systems allow for continuous processing of materials, minimizing manual handling and human error. Modern machines feature digital readouts and anti-kickback mechanisms, ensuring safe operation even during extended runs. By standardizing the thicknessing process, manufacturers can reduce waste and optimize material usage, directly impacting the bottom line through increased profitability and reduced scrap rates.

Maintenance for Longevity and Performance

To maintain peak planer machine application performance, regular maintenance is vital. The cutting blades require periodic inspection and sharpening to prevent tearing and excessive strain on the motor. Dust collection systems must be kept clear to ensure visibility and prevent clogging. Adhering to a strict schedule for bearing replacement and alignment checks ensures the machine operates silently and efficiently. Proper maintenance not only extends the machinery's lifespan but also safeguards the quality of every pass it takes.
